{-| A name is a non-empty list of alternating 'Id's and 'Hole's. A normal name
is represented by a singleton list, and operators are represented by a list
with 'Hole's where the arguments should go. For instance: @[Hole,Id "+",Hole]@
is infix addition.
Equality and ordering on @Name@s are defined to ignore range so same names
in different locations are equal.
-}

-- | From notation with names to notation with indices.
mkNotation :: [HoleName] -> [String] -> Either String Notation
mkNotation _ [] = fail "empty notation is disallowed"
mkNotation holes ids = do
xs <- mapM mkPart ids
when (not (isAlternating xs)) $ fail "syntax must alternate holes and non-holes"
when (not (isExprLinear xs)) $ fail "syntax must use holes exactly once"
when (not (isLambdaLinear xs)) $ fail "syntax must use binding holes exactly once"
return xs
where mkPart ident =
case (findIndices (\x -> ident == holeName x) holes,
findIndices (\x -> case x of LambdaHole ident' _ -> ident == ident';_ -> False) holes) of
([],[x]) -> return $ BindHole x
([x], []) -> return $ NormalHole x
([], []) -> return $ IdPart ident
_ -> fail "hole names must be unique"
isExprLinear xs = sort [ x | NormalHole x <- xs] == [ i | (i,h) <- zip [0..] holes ]
isLambdaLinear xs = sort [ x | BindHole x <- xs] == [ i | (i,h) <- zip [0..] holes, isLambdaHole h ]
isAlternating :: [GenPart] -> Bool
isAlternating [] = __IMPOSSIBLE__
isAlternating [x] = True
isAlternating (x:y:xs) = isAHole x /= isAHole y && isAlternating (y:xs)
